Unto the end, a psalm for David. To thee, O Lord, have I lifted up my soul. |
2. | In thee, O my God, I put my trust; let me not be ashamed. |
3. | Neither let my enemies laugh at me: for none of them that wait on thee shall be confounded. |
4. | Let all them be confounded that act unjust things without cause. Shew, O Lord, thy ways to me, and teach me thy paths. |
5. | Direct me in thy truth, and teach me; for thou art God my Saviour; and on thee have I waited all the day long. |
6. | Remember, O Lord, thy bowels of compassion; and thy mercies that are from the beginning of the world. |
7. | The sins of my youth and my ignorances do not remember. According to thy mercy remember thou me: for thy goodness' sake, O Lord. |
8. | The Lord is sweet and righteous: therefore he will give a law to sinners in the way. |
9. | He will guide the mild in judgment: he will teach the meek his ways. |
10. | All the ways of the Lord are mercy and truth, to them that seek after his covenant and his testimonies. |
11. | For thy name's sake, O Lord, thou wilt pardon my sin: for it is great. |
12. | Who is the man that feareth the Lord? He hath appointed him a law in the way he hath chosen. |
13. | His soul shall dwell in good things: and his seed shall inherit the land. |
14. | The Lord is a firmament to them that fear him: and his covenant shall be made manifest to them. |
15. | My eyes are ever towards the Lord: for he shall pluck my feet out of the snare. |
16. | Look thou upon me, and have mercy on me; for I am alone and poor. |
17. | The troubles of my heart are multiplied: deliver me from my necessities. |
18. | See my abjection and my labour; and forgive me all my sins. |
19. | Consider my enemies for they are multiplied, and have hated me with an unjust hatred. |
20. | Keep thou my soul, and deliver me: I shall not be ashamed, for I have hoped in thee. |
21. | The innocent and the upright have adhered to me: because I have waited on thee. |
22. | Deliver Israel, O God, from all his tribulations. |
